Output 665e5452b72d83876470e20e6f75727a7a183ef3b7592f45b249de9a8e1468d8:0

value
123854452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d27312c23bbffa875c715f7301ed4a39df08f4 OP_EQUAL
address
3H5fZ4PTXmJoGmeA7mQhvxJCvxC2r6d53d
transaction
665e5452b72d83876470e20e6f75727a7a183ef3b7592f45b249de9a8e1468d8
spent
true